Salina, KS vs Shawnee, KS
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Salina is 25.7% cheaper than Shawnee. With a cost index of 72 vs 97,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Salina to Shawnee should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Salina is $911/month compared to $1,233/month in Shawnee — a 26%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Salina is more affordable at $164,500 median vs $332,900.
Median household income in Salina is $60,624 compared to $106,312 in Shawnee (-43%). While Shawnee is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Salina spend roughly 18% of their income on rent, more than the 13.9% in Shawnee.
